What Is the Ideal Temperature Range for Crested Geckos?

Maintaining a range of 72-78°f (22-26°c) is essential for keeping crested geckos healthy. This temperature replicates the warmth found in their natural environment and ensures that bodily functions—from digestion to energy metabolism—operate optimally. In terrariums, this controlled range helps geckos regulate their metabolic rate effectively. Studies indicate that temperatures below this range result in sluggish digestion and low energy, while temperatures above can lead to overheating and stress.

Ambient room heat and the terrarium’s internal conditions constantly influence this range. Crested geckos require cooler spots within their enclosure to retreat from heat when necessary, creating a natural gradient. This gradient not only supports behavioral thermoregulation, allowing for natural movement and exploration, but also improves overall health by preventing continuous stress and lethargy.

Temperature also impacts their immune response. A stable range supports effective digestion and nutrient absorption, reducing risks of metabolic bone disease—a common issue when conditions are improper. By achieving this balance, pet owners can mimic the gecko’s natural behavior of seeking sunlit areas and retreating to shaded spots.

A practical method for ensuring the correct range is to set up reliable heating equipment like ceramic heat emitters or heating pads, which provide consistent, measurable warmth. Maintaining 72-78°f ensures skin and tissues stay free of stress-induced compounds and supports the gecko’s circadian rhythm, indirectly influencing feeding cycles and basking periods. Keeping temperatures within a safe window also discourages pathogens like mildew, which can thrive in overly damp or warm conditions.

What Are the Signs of Temperature Stress in Crested Geckos?

a close-up view of a crested gecko perched on a sleek, modern terrarium, showcasing signs of temperature stress with mottled skin and a lethargic posture against a vibrant indoor background, illuminated by soft, artificial lighting to highlight the gecko's condition.

When crested geckos experience temperature stress, they exhibit clear behavioral and physiological signs. A gecko that is too cold may appear lethargic, hide for extended periods, and lose interest in food, while one that is too hot may become restless, display rapid breathing or panting, and show other signs of distress.

Physiologically, a drop in temperature can slow digestion, leading to extended inactivity and even constipation. Excessive heat, however, may cause the skin to become flushed or mottled, and geckos might drop their tail as a survival mechanism. Prolonged exposure to improper temperatures can lead to dehydration—evident through sunken eyes, dry skin, and reduced elasticity in the tail. In a too-warm environment, the animal may be observed shifting frequently between warmer and cooler spots, unable to settle in one area.

Other signs include a noticeable change in appetite and reduced feeding, leading to weight loss and weakened immunity. In states of stress, reproductive activities diminish as the gecko’s system prioritizes survival. Even the shedding process can be affected, with geckos exhibiting incomplete or overly frequent shedding, which may lead to skin infections if the old skin is not completely sloughed off. Recognizing these signs early through regular observation and digital monitoring allows for timely adjustments to ensure a healthy environment.

How Do You Accurately Measure Temperature in a Crested Gecko Terrarium?

Accurate temperature measurement is critical to maintaining optimal environmental conditions in a crested gecko terrarium. The process begins with selecting reliable thermometers. Digital thermometers with calibration capabilities are preferred for their accuracy and ease of data logging. While infrared thermometers can be used for spot measurements, they may not consistently capture the ambient temperature variations that occur within the enclosure. For continuous monitoring, dual-probe digital thermometers are ideal since they record both air and substrate temperatures.

Placement is key when measuring temperature. One thermometer should be positioned near the basking area to capture the highest temperatures, and another should be located in a cooler area to ensure a proper thermal gradient exists. Using devices with data logging functions helps track fluctuations over time, while regular calibration against a known standard guarantees ongoing accuracy.

Wireless sensors that connect to smartphone apps offer real-time monitoring without disturbing the gecko. These sensors can send alerts if temperatures drift out of the ideal range. It is important to avoid placing thermometers too close to heaters or in direct sunlight, as such placements can lead to inaccurate, skewed readings. Mounting devices at mid-level—where geckos are most active—provides the most representative data.

The substrate also influences thermometer readings; different materials retain heat differently, so using instruments that can measure both air and substrate temperature is recommended. Regular cleaning and maintenance of the terrarium prevent dust and moisture from affecting the thermometer’s performance.

Which Thermometers Are Best for Monitoring Crested Gecko Enclosures?

Digital thermometers equipped with both air and substrate sensors are most suitable for monitoring crested gecko enclosures. These devices provide continuous, real-time readings essential for tracking the temperature gradient throughout the terrarium. Dual-probe models are favored as they simultaneously record ambient and substrate temperatures within the prescribed range of 72-78°f. Models with remote wireless capabilities further enhance monitoring by logging data discreetly and alerting owners to deviations.

Where Should You Place Thermometers for Accurate Readings?

Thermometers should be strategically placed in various parts of the terrarium. One probe belongs near the basking area to capture the highest temperature, while another should be positioned in a cooler zone to confirm that a thermal gradient is maintained. Placing sensors at mid-level heights is recommended because crested geckos move about this area during activity. Avoid positions too close to heating elements or reflective surfaces to ensure unbiased readings.

How Often Should You Check and Record Terrarium Temperature?

It is recommended to check and record the terrarium’s temperature at least twice daily—once during the peak of the day and once during the cooler parts of the day or at night. Regular logging provides critical insights into the consistency of the environment over a complete cycle, and periodic calibration of thermometers is essential for long-term accuracy. Modern digital thermometers that feature data logging can simplify this task by tracking temperature trends and aiding troubleshooting efforts.

What Are the Best Heating Methods to Maintain Ideal Temperature for Crested Geckos?

a well-designed reptile terrarium illuminated by a combination of ceramic heat emitters and precise heat lamps showcases a balanced environment tailored for crested geckos, with a clear emphasis on efficient temperature management and optimal basking areas.

Selecting the best heating method is critical in maintaining the ideal temperature. Common options include ceramic heat emitters, heating pads, and heat lamps—each with its distinct benefits and drawbacks. Ceramic heat emitters are popular as they distribute heat evenly without emitting light, thus preserving the gecko’s natural circadian rhythm. Under-terrain heating pads gradually raise substrate temperature with gentle warmth, although precautions must be taken to prevent hot spots. Heat lamps offer localized warmth and can simulate natural sunbathing but must be positioned carefully to avoid overheating.

Often, a combination of a heating pad and an overhead ceramic emitter is used to create a balanced gradient that caters to both basking and cooler resting areas. Selecting energy-efficient, safe-for-continuous-use devices that work with thermostat controls is essential for precise management.

A common challenge is achieving even heat distribution throughout the terrarium. Employing diverse heating methods simultaneously, with adjustments made for the enclosure’s size and shape, is advisable. Manufacturers design these devices specifically for reptile use to provide stable, near-constant output and avoid sudden spikes. Regular assessments using calibrated thermometers offer benchmarks to further fine-tune the system using a thermostat that can automatically adjust output if necessary.

How Do Heating Pads Compare to Ceramic Heat Emitters and Heat Lamps?

Heating pads, placed beneath the terrarium, offer consistent warmth to the substrate and the base. Ceramic heat emitters, producing heat without light, are ideal for nocturnal heating without disturbing the gecko's rest cycle. Heat lamps provide directional light and heat to simulate natural sunlight, benefiting geckos requiring a basking spot. Each method has unique advantages: heating pads provide broad warmth; ceramic emitters maintain a steady output without disruptive light; and heat lamps deliver concentrated heat that can be adjusted as needed. Studies note that heat lamps, if not monitored, may cause temperature spikes, while ceramic heat emitters and heating pads generally ensure more stable conditions.

What Are the Safety Considerations When Using Heating Devices?

Safety is paramount when integrating heating devices. Overheating can lead to heat stroke or thermal burns, so devices with automatic shutoff features or thermostatic controls are crucial. Ensuring that heating elements are securely mounted and kept at safe distances from flammable substrates and decorations is essential. Regular inspections for wiring integrity and cleaning of components help prevent dust buildup and potential malfunctions. Following manufacturers’ guidelines regarding placement in relation to basking and resting areas is also important for spread and diffusion of heat. Using products designed specifically for reptile enclosures minimizes risks and ensures safe, efficient operation.

Why Is Using a Thermostat Essential for Regulating Crested Gecko Terrarium Temperature?

A thermostat is essential for regulating a crested gecko’s terrarium temperature because it acts as a central control mechanism to prevent overheating or underheating. By continuously monitoring the ambient temperature and automatically adjusting the output of the heating element, a thermostat maintains the terrarium within the narrow range of 72-78°f. This precision helps avoid sudden spikes or drops that could stress the gecko and disrupt metabolic processes.

Thermostats also enhance energy efficiency by ensuring that heaters operate only when necessary. Modern digital thermostats can even mimic natural day-night fluctuations, allowing geckos to experience conditions similar to their native habitat. During seasonal transitions, these devices become especially critical as they adjust for external temperature variations. Many models include built-in redundancy and alert features, providing early warnings if temperatures deviate from the preset range. This not only safeguards the gecko’s health but also helps reduce energy consumption and prolongs the lifespan of the heating products.

How Does a Thermostat Prevent Overheating and Underheating?

A thermostat prevents overheating and underheating by continuously sensing the terrarium’s temperature and comparing it to the pre-set range of 72-78°f. If the temperature exceeds this range, it automatically reduces power to the heating device, and if it falls below, it increases power to bring the temperature back to the target. This continuous, real-time balancing act ensures a stable thermal environment for the gecko.

What Types of Thermostats Are Suitable for Crested Gecko Enclosures?

Suitable thermostats for these enclosures include digital models that can be plugged in or hardwired. They typically offer programmable settings, remote monitoring, and sometimes dual-probe options to monitor both ambient air and substrate temperatures. These features, along with ease of calibration and quick response times, make them well suited for maintaining the delicate balance needed in a crested gecko terrarium.

How to Set Up and Calibrate a Thermostat for Optimal Temperature Control?

Proper thermostat setup involves a few key steps. First, install the thermostat where it can accurately gauge the overall ambient temperature—away from direct heat sources or drafts. Connect it to the heating device and perform an initial calibration by comparing its readings with a known standard thermometer. Adjust the settings to stabilize the reading within 72-78°f, then secure the unit according to manufacturer's guidelines. It is advisable to test the system over several days and perform regular recalibrations, especially when seasonal changes occur.

How Does Temperature Interact With Humidity to Affect Crested Gecko Well-Being?

a brightly lit, modern terrarium setup showcasing a balanced environment for crested geckos, featuring an automatic misting system and humidity gauges that illustrate the optimal temperature and humidity levels for their well-being.

Temperature and humidity are interdependent factors that greatly affect crested gecko well-being. The ideal temperature range of 72-78°f works best when it is paired with a specific humidity level, typically between 50% and 70%. When balanced, this combination attracts beneficial microfauna and supports natural gecko behaviors. The right humidity level facilitates the shedding process, maintains healthy skin, and prevents problems such as mold growth or respiratory distress that can arise when conditions are too moist.

Maintaining correct humidity also aids thermoregulation by preventing rapid moisture loss from the skin, which is crucial since dehydration can exacerbate stress. Additionally, proper humidity helps preserve the structural integrity of the substrate by deterring the formation of detrimental mildew. Employing systems such as automatic misting devices or humidity controllers in combination with appropriate heating ensures that both factors remain balanced.

What Is the Ideal Humidity Range to Complement the Temperature?

The ideal humidity range to complement the 72-78°f temperature is between 50% and 70%. This range supports proper hydration, efficient shedding, and skin health while preventing the growth of fungus or mold.

How Can You Maintain Proper Humidity While Controlling Temperature?

To maintain proper humidity along with temperature, use integrated systems that measure and regulate both factors. Automatic misting devices paired with digital humidity sensors can adjust moisture levels in real time based on temperature fluctuations. Additionally, using a well-ventilated, moisture-absorbing substrate can help stabilize humidity levels. Regular observation and periodic adjustments ensure humidity and temperature remain aligned with the recommended ranges, safeguarding the gecko’s overall health.

What Are Common Problems When Temperature and Humidity Are Imbalanced?

Imbalances can lead to various issues. High temperatures with low humidity may cause rapid moisture loss and dehydration, increasing the risk of heat stroke or skin injuries. Conversely, high temperature combined with high humidity can encourage the growth of pathogens such as mildew or fungus, potentially leading to respiratory issues. Similarly, low temperatures paired with high humidity might slow metabolism, resulting in lethargy and decreased appetite. Regular monitoring and timely adjustments of both heating and misting systems are essential to prevent such complications.

How Can You Troubleshoot Common Temperature Issues in Crested Gecko Enclosures?

Troubleshooting temperature issues requires a systematic approach. A sudden temperature drop may be due to a malfunctioning heater or power outage, while overheating might result from blocked ventilation or unregulated heat lamps. In both cases, verifying thermostat calibration and using a backup heat source is key. Additionally, inspect for blockages in airflow, malfunctioning sensors, or faulty wiring, and perform regular maintenance and cleaning of heating elements. Documenting temperature fluctuations over several days can help distinguish between transient problems and recurring issues. Employing redundant systems, such as combining a heating pad with a ceramic heat emitter, further minimizes risks.

What Should You Do if Your Crested Gecko’s Terrarium Is Too Cold?

If the terrarium’s temperature falls below 72°f, first verify that the heating device is operating properly by checking thermometer readings. Adjust the thermostat or increase the heating power as necessary, and ensure there are no drafts or bypasses in the enclosure that could be contributing to the low temperature. If needed, temporarily supplement with a portable heat source while addressing the underlying issue, and continue to monitor the environment closely.

How to Respond to Overheating in a Crested Gecko Habitat?

When the terrarium becomes too hot, immediate cooling is necessary. Turn off or reduce the heat source, increase ventilation, or temporarily relocate the gecko to a cooler area. Check for signs of distress, such as panting or rapid breathing, and adjust the placement or intensity of the heat source. Adding barriers or shade structures within the enclosure can create cooler microhabitats, and quick intervention is essential to avoid long-term stress or heat-related injuries.

When Is It Necessary to Adjust Temperature Based on Seasonal Changes?

Seasonal changes in room temperature can affect the terrarium’s internal conditions. In cooler months, increasing the heat output may be necessary, while in warmer seasons, reducing heat or using intermittent heating might be appropriate. Continuous monitoring of both external and internal temperatures, along with regular reviews and calibrations, helps to adjust the system as needed to ensure stability despite seasonal fluctuations.

How to Modify Heating Setup During Cooler Months?

During cooler months, enhance the heating setup by increasing the output—this may include adding extra heating pads or slightly raising thermostat settings. Ensure that the heat is evenly distributed across the terrarium. Monitor substrate temperatures, which may lag behind air temperature, and consider installing an additional heat source if needed. Supplementary insulation such as draft guards or thermal mats can help retain heat and reduce energy loss.

How to Prevent Overheating During Warmer Seasons?

In warmer seasons, preventing overheating involves reducing the power of heat sources, improving airflow with fans or adjustable vents, and possibly relocating the terrarium to a cooler part of the house. Using shading within the enclosure can help create a balanced thermal gradient. Consistent monitoring ensures that even during external heat spikes, the climate remains within the ideal range. Adjust thermostat settings accordingly and consider intermittent use of heating devices.

How Does Ambient Room Temperature Affect Terrarium Temperature?

The ambient room temperature sets the baseline for the terrarium’s internal climate. Even well-calibrated heating systems can struggle if the room temperature is far from the optimal range. In cooler rooms, additional heating may be required, while in warmer environments, passive cooling or lower heat settings may be necessary. Owners must factor in the overall climate of the room when designing a heating setup and select thermostats that adjust based on ambient conditions.
